    Is it comfortable? No, never. Don’t believe anyone. The originators of the saddle hunting movement, Chris and John Eberhart will never tell you it is comfortable. It is not. In fact for extended sits it will get painful. It is effective, stealthy to set up and flexible allowing you to have tens of stand locations rather than just a few. Neither Chris nor John use a platform either. Use a platform and you might as well carry a stand. Neither uses sticks. They carry in a small bag of 15 or so screw in steps. You try walking through brush with four sticks and a platform strapped onto your already bulky pack, carrying a bow. All this gizmology is not saddle hunting, its stand hunting from a few fixed locations without a hard seat. You’d be more comfortable and nimble carrying 15 screw in steps and a light Lone Wolf stand. FAD... Read Bowhunting Pressured Whitetails by Eberhart if you want to learn about real stand hunting. It can be simple, and powerful, but its not for the faint of heart.

    Thank you everyone for the comments so far. As of now I am enjoying the saddle. However, for bigger people it does have its shortcomings. It is not a one size fits all and I knew that would probably be the case going into it. I got this particular setup simply to test it out as well as the fact it came with everything needed as a complete set. When I placed my order it came with the 20” hawk sticks, platform, and saddle kit. There were some shipping issues and the sticks showed up much later than the saddle. The platform still isn’t slated for availability so I ended up ordering a trophyline platform (that I absolutely love btw, there will be a review on that at a later date) for me personally I am 6’2” and 275# 38” waist. The saddle itself is a little on the small side so after a couple hours I do experience some discomfort. However because of the nature of the saddle you can make small minor adjustments to the tether length and hight as well as your body position on stand to make it more comfortable or change the pressure points. Quality of the saddle itself is acceptable but some of the “extras” that come with it leave a little to be desired. At the end of the day though I’d say if your a bigger person I would probably look at other options. I will be doing a follow up review here soon as well so stay tuned.
